91.31: SLI multi-gpu rendering has been disabled
I just wiped and reloaded Windows and installed the new 91.31 drivers.
After restarting to complete the driver install, I now get a baloon tip from the nvidia tray icon saying "SLI multi-gpu rendering has been disabled" plus some more detailed information about how to get further help. This is a brand new clean install of Windows XP Pro SP2 with a BFG 6600 GT OC AGP card. Between the 6600 GT card and the AGP motherboard there is no way I could use SLI no matter how much I wanted to. Although the SLI section of the nvidia control panel says insists that this card supports SLI. There are no other options given to enable or disable it. Has anybody else gotten this? Everything else seems to work fine, just the baloon tip after each system restart is really anoying. - g0pher |

In article , g0pher says...
I just wiped and reloaded Windows and installed the new 91.31 drivers. After restarting to complete the driver install, I now get a baloon tip from the nvidia tray icon saying "SLI multi-gpu rendering has been disabled" plus some more detailed information about how to get further help. This is a brand new clean install of Windows XP Pro SP2 with a BFG 6600 GT OC AGP card. Between the 6600 GT card and the AGP motherboard there is no way I could use SLI no matter how much I wanted to. Although the SLI section of the nvidia control panel says insists that this card supports SLI. There are no other options given to enable or disable it. Has anybody else gotten this? Everything else seems to work fine, just the baloon tip after each system restart is really anoying. THe easiest way to fix it is to click Start, right click on the menu, select properties, click on the Taskbar tab then Customise next to Hide Inactive Icons, select the nVIDIA one and set it to always hide. -- Conor Who the **** said I was trying to endear myself to anyone? |
